BCH First in Central Iowa to Offer Sensor-Assisted Technology for Knee Replacement
Boone County Hospital now utilizes an innovative sensor-assisted technology called VERASENSE in total knee replacement (TKR). This disposable orthopaedic device used for primary and revision TKR is the latest innovation in sensor and wireless communications. New Administrator Joins BCH and Clinics
Tacy Hyberger is the new Assistant Administrator for Clinic and Physician Services for Boone County Hospital (BCH). Tacy worked at BCH from 1998 to 2008 as House Supervisor and as the Emergency Department Director.
